Profile Summary

The role is defined to build a strong interaction with the public and students interested in astronomy, so being able to communicate what space science and astronomy do in public.

Key Roles and Responsibilities

1. Conducting Astronomy Observations, training in telescope and other equipment during evening and night observations at SPACE sites.

2. Maintain the quality standard of program conduction

3. Plan client programs/sessions/activities/events on time, freeze, and follow the agenda

4. Organizing outreach events, which are conducted under the banner of SPACE India.

5. Representing the company across various media through interviews, participation in the talk shows; write papers and articles in magazines and newspapers as per the company’s media policy.

6. Help in the promotion and propagation of astronomy and space science education.

7. Organize and participate in events like fairs, quiz competitions, observations, Public Watches

8. Participate and volunteer for popularizing Astronomy and Space Science among the masses.

9. Implement multiple teaching techniques focusing on student-centered activities that incorporate various learning styles and active practice of the language.

Space Technology and Education Pvt. Ltd., also recognized as SPACE India, is a pioneer organization with a legacy of 24 years in developing and popularizing Astronomy, Space Science, and STEM education and experiences at Grassroots level (K-12) and beyond. As a registered Space Tutor of the Indian Space Research Organization (ISRO), SPACE India has been instrumental in creating an impact through science, and aligns with the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als.
